Justice HARTMAN delivered the opinion of the court:

Plaintiff Gregory L. Abrams, once a member of the Jeffrey Valley Congregation of Jehovah's Witnesses, brought suit against individual members of that congregation and the Watchtower Bible and Tract Society of New York (sometimes collectively defendants), alleging that defendants conspired to remove him from the congregation by causing two female members to accuse him falsely of grave and serious sins.
